Plant hormones are a group of organic substances that occur naturally and influence plant physiological processes. Plant hormones are also called phytohormones and work as growth regulators. Main processes affected are growth, differentiation, and development. It is well known that several plant hormones are involved in the regulation of fruit development and ripening across fleshy and dry fruits.
